2. Navigating the Skechers Size Chart 🌐

The Skechers size chart is your best friend when shopping online. Here’s how to read it:

  • US Sizes: These are the standard sizes used in the United States. They’re usually listed first and are the easiest to understand.
  • UK Sizes: If you’re across the pond, UK sizes are your go-to. They’re slightly different from US sizes, so pay attention to the conversions.
  • EUR Sizes: For our European friends, EUR sizes are based on the metric system. They’re often more precise and can help you find that perfect fit.
  • CM Length: This is the length of your foot in centimeters. It’s a great way to double-check your size, especially if you’re between sizes.

TIP: Always measure your feet before you shop. Feet can change size over time, so it’s a good idea to get an accurate measurement. 📏

3. Common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them 🚧

Even with a size chart, things can go wrong. Here are some common pitfalls and how to avoid them:

  • Forgetting to Measure Both Feet: Your feet might not be the same size. Always measure both and go with the larger one.
  • Ignoring Width: Some Skechers styles come in different widths (D, EE, etc.). If you have wide feet, don’t overlook this detail.
  • Not Trying On Before Buying: If possible, try on the shoes in-store. Walking around in them can help you determine if they’re the right fit.
  • Buying Based on Previous Sizes: Just because you’ve always worn a certain size doesn’t mean it will fit in every style. Always refer to the size chart.

Remember, the goal is to find shoes that fit well and feel comfortable, not just ones that match your usual size. 🎯
